If you've recorded a loan payment as a cheque (also explained in the above article about setting up your loan in QBO), you'll simply delete the cheque by following these steps:
1. From the left menu, select Expenses, and choose Expenses.
2. In the Expense Transactions window, find the expense to delete.
3. From the Action ▼drop-down menu, select Delete.
4. Select Yes to confirm that you want to delete the transaction. Once you delete an expense, only the Audit log maintains a record of it. To open the Audit log, select Reports from the left menu and enter Audit Log in the search bar.
